Selena Gomez hits back at Senate candidate who called for her to be 'deported' for sympathizing with migrants
Selena Gomez thanked a Senate candidate for the 'laugh and the threat' after he said she should be 'deported' for a tearful video sympathizing with Mexican migrants. The actress and pop star, 32, sobbed on camera in response to President Donald Trump's mass deportations of undocumented immigrants - a policy he campaigned on ahead of the 2024 election. She swiftly deleted the video, but sparked backlash from Republicans and MAGA supporters.
